Retire the now-unused gdbarch handle_segmentation_fault hook.

* gdbarch.c: Regenerate.
	* gdbarch.h: Regenerate.
	* gdbarch.sh (handle_segmentation_fault): Remove method.
	* infrun.c (handle_segmentation_fault): Remove.
	(print_signal_received_reason): Remove call to
	handle_segmentation_fault.
